System For Key Exchange In A Content Centric Network

  • Published: May 4, 2017
  • Earliest Priority: Oct 29 2015
  • Family: 8
  • Cited Works: 0
  • Cited by: 3
  • Cites: 10
  • Additional Info: Full text

One embodiment provides a system that facilitates secure communication between computing entities. During operation, the system generates, by a content-consuming device, a first key based on a first consumer-share key and a previously received producer-share key. The system constructs a first interest packet that includes the first consumer-share key and a nonce token which is used as a pre-image of a previously generated first nonce, wherein the first interest has a name that includes a first prefix, and wherein the first nonce is used to establish a session between the content-consuming device and a content-producing device. In response to the nonce token being verified by the content-producing device, the system receives a first content-object packet with a payload that includes a first resumption indicator encrypted based on a second key. The system generates the second key based on a second consumer-share key and the first content-object packet.

Download PDF
Document Preview
Document History
  • Publication: May 4, 2017
  • Application: Oct 29, 2015
    US US 201514927034 A
  • Priority: Oct 29, 2015
    US US 201514927034 A

Sign in to the Lens